A construction services provider is currently seeking a reliable Dumper Operator to work in Lydney, Gloucestershire. The role involves operating a site dumper while assisting groundworkers and supporting day-to-day site operations.
Candidates need a valid NPORS/CPCS dumper ticket, a positive attitude, and reliability. This position offers a pay rate of £20.00 - £22.00 per hour, and local or commuting candidates to Lydney are preferred.
